    "Surely You're Joking, Mr. Feynman!": Adventures of a Curious Character is an edited collection of reminiscences by the Nobel Prize –winning physicist Richard Feynman . The book, published in 1985, covers a variety of instances in Feynman's life.

    Ralph Leighton (/ ˈ l eɪ t ən / LAY-tən; born 1949) [citation needed] is an American biographer, film producer, [citation needed] and friend of the late physicist Richard Feynman. [1] He recorded Feynman relating stories of his life. Leighton has released some of the recordings as The Feynman Tapes.

    Infinity is a 1996 American biographical film about the romantic life of physicist Richard Feynman. Feynman was played by Matthew Broderick , who also directed and co-produced the film.     Zorthian and Feynman's attempts to teach each other physics and art respectively are described in Feynman's autobiography Surely You're Joking, Mr. Feynman!. Zorthian's teaching inspired Feynman to take up drawing, a pastime he continued for the rest of his life.
